For kerberos clients /etc/krb5.keytab isn't loaded at system startup. ktutil shows an empty list until the existing keytab is loaded. With the next reboot the list is empty again until reread by "echo rkt /etc/krb5.keytab | ktutil".<br />
<br />
If no other means or login allowed:<br />
keylist is empty -> ksu fails<br />
ssh to this system with a proper authenticated user from an other system -> password required
